Ayush Sharma
3b9f2fcc8c
Revert "Unhide IpPrefix(InetAddress, int)" am: 758ead6dd3 am: ea0caefdd2 am: 6c75679f1d
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1927303
Change-Id: I2c5800b1850917dcf573e0456b80734b847689c2
2021-12-16 15:52:42 +00:00
Ayush Sharma
a5b1376b1a
Revert "Add CTS tests for exclude VPN routes APIs" am: f4882153ed am: bf8d513fda am: 2623bb352e
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1927302
Change-Id: I81f1ae63aa32ead0eb5d0b3b65fd21e4ad07ab28
2021-12-16 15:52:37 +00:00
Ayush Sharma
ea0caefdd2
Revert "Unhide IpPrefix(InetAddress, int)" am: 758ead6dd3
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1927303
Change-Id: If3840f48333e48895701b12f201e34166e3a3136
2021-12-16 15:16:53 +00:00
Ayush Sharma
bf8d513fda
Revert "Add CTS tests for exclude VPN routes APIs" am: f4882153ed
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1927302
Change-Id: Id9904952c064d9bd25aa21121a3ed46af9ad7983
2021-12-16 15:16:50 +00:00
Ayush Sharma
758ead6dd3
Revert "Unhide IpPrefix(InetAddress, int)"
...
Revert "Add APIs that allow to exclude routes from VPN"
Revert "Suppress NewApi warnings for @SystemApi -> public APIs"
Revert "Add VpnServiceBuilderShim for VpnService.Builder"
Revert submission 1551943-vpn-impl
Reason for revert: <DroidMonitor-triggered revert due to breakage https://android-build.googleplex.com/builds/quarterdeck?branch=aosp-master&target=mainline_modules_x86_64-userdebug&lkgb=8007224&lkbb=8008168&fkbb=8007902 >, bug b/210979001
Reverted Changes:
I0e7aa077a:Add VpnServiceBuilderShim for VpnService.Builder
Ib12f5ab39:Suppress NewApi warnings for @SystemApi -> public ...
I59b9185cf:Unhide RouteInfo#getType and related fields
Ie5b62b2b2:Unhide IpPrefix(InetAddress, int)
I993a32d40:Add CTS tests for exclude VPN routes APIs
Ib24b2d3fb:Suppress NewApi warnings for @SystemApi -> public ...
Ic3b10464a:Add APIs that allow to exclude routes from VPN
Change-Id: Id0c373fb042a98c1c68807acf7fcfe456520ebe2
BUG: 210979001
2021-12-16 14:40:13 +00:00
Ayush Sharma
f4882153ed
Revert "Add CTS tests for exclude VPN routes APIs"
...
Revert "Add APIs that allow to exclude routes from VPN"
Revert "Suppress NewApi warnings for @SystemApi -> public APIs"
Revert "Add VpnServiceBuilderShim for VpnService.Builder"
Revert submission 1551943-vpn-impl
Reason for revert: <DroidMonitor-triggered revert due to breakage https://android-build.googleplex.com/builds/quarterdeck?branch=aosp-master&target=mainline_modules_x86_64-userdebug&lkgb=8007224&lkbb=8008168&fkbb=8007902 >, bug b/210979001
Reverted Changes:
I0e7aa077a:Add VpnServiceBuilderShim for VpnService.Builder
Ib12f5ab39:Suppress NewApi warnings for @SystemApi -> public ...
I59b9185cf:Unhide RouteInfo#getType and related fields
Ie5b62b2b2:Unhide IpPrefix(InetAddress, int)
I993a32d40:Add CTS tests for exclude VPN routes APIs
Ib24b2d3fb:Suppress NewApi warnings for @SystemApi -> public ...
Ic3b10464a:Add APIs that allow to exclude routes from VPN
Change-Id: Ic4f86f405c395f1356de1a6f8cf9e92692d953ce
BUG: 210979001
2021-12-16 14:40:13 +00:00
Aaron Huang
767e59c01b
Merge "Add makeDependencies method in IpSecService related tests" am: 3c1e7398a4 am: c6b730ce81 am: 1bf71ba427
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1904464
Change-Id: I8598dd981e5efab1153e0b2068db45e8e2ee5510
2021-12-16 13:22:00 +00:00
Aaron Huang
3c1e7398a4
Merge "Add makeDependencies method in IpSecService related tests"
2021-12-16 12:32:41 +00:00
Taras Antoshchuk
89bb3ff718
Merge changes from topic "vpn-impl" am: 8be6ba36dc am: e0895f355a am: a44507ec2b
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1551943
Change-Id: I42b02315fdcc62704d8f92f3bc7bf462dc5b9edf
2021-12-16 12:04:31 +00:00
Taras Antoshchuk
3c54cc1c9f
Unhide IpPrefix(InetAddress, int) am: a5a1b80222 am: 6cf24035ca am: 21e769376b
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1831813
Change-Id: Ie4953b68049f45cee2f1097e890f6c7fbb5b99a8
2021-12-16 12:04:28 +00:00
Taras Antoshchuk
cf34e56459
Unhide RouteInfo#getType and related fields am: 62065db8d1 am: d44b6b9629 am: b8187e3b4a
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1784543
Change-Id: I39470864beda342f04b6729d3e2222c8da9215ba
2021-12-16 12:04:23 +00:00
Taras Antoshchuk
6cf24035ca
Unhide IpPrefix(InetAddress, int) am: a5a1b80222
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1831813
Change-Id: I0f0cfe71d555249e08e4a3946295fd028864c323
2021-12-16 11:34:50 +00:00
Taras Antoshchuk
d44b6b9629
Unhide RouteInfo#getType and related fields am: 62065db8d1
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1784543
Change-Id: I2af963e9918ae08e31bce57283cf3fefdb64c3a7
2021-12-16 11:34:49 +00:00
Taras Antoshchuk
8be6ba36dc
Merge changes from topic "vpn-impl"
...
* changes:
Add CTS tests for exclude VPN routes APIs
Unhide IpPrefix(InetAddress, int)
Unhide RouteInfo#getType and related fields
2021-12-16 11:13:33 +00:00
Aaron Huang
70e3b16dcf
Merge "Change to use Dependencies in IpSecService Tests" am: 286c0e5336 am: 90f307450c am: e4d6a01bcd
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1904463
Change-Id: Ic7621cd1ae8faaab4021d33e42ccc2d9c4237c9b
2021-12-15 08:51:23 +00:00
Aaron Huang
286c0e5336
Merge "Change to use Dependencies in IpSecService Tests"
2021-12-15 07:53:23 +00:00
Xin Li
93c578c7ca
Merge "Merge Android 12 QPR1"
2021-12-14 20:27:32 +00:00
Xin Li
06e662f597
Merge Android 12 QPR1
...
Bug: 210511427
Merged-In: I4bfb3fc34f10d0c84dafc949f4e7f604d98244e1
Change-Id: I9ff07a2256a709115a3d84370cfcd5fadc34b3a9
2021-12-14 08:39:15 -08:00
Remi NGUYEN VAN
4d44c36ed6
Merge "Move TestableNetworkAgent to Common Util Location" am: eef1e2033d am: d71552978c am: 7bf5e7e325
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1908520
Change-Id: I19e75581c18901eef23d4dd50ec62bbc6a8f66da
2021-12-14 13:37:47 +00:00
Remi NGUYEN VAN
d71552978c
Merge "Move TestableNetworkAgent to Common Util Location" am: eef1e2033d
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1908520
Change-Id: I7f95f6a3d4750e4dfef2ec4e61db1837661f119d
2021-12-14 13:09:19 +00:00
Remi NGUYEN VAN
eef1e2033d
Merge "Move TestableNetworkAgent to Common Util Location"
2021-12-14 12:49:15 +00:00
Jean Chalard
4c06947fce
Merge "Remove NetworkCapabilities#combine*" am: 5469fa6e59 am: d5c9c3f4ae am: ad1cd95c10
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1919248
Change-Id: I58462f6d0303803ffd43333b67865c57edef39a3
2021-12-14 11:46:08 +00:00
Jean Chalard
d5c9c3f4ae
Merge "Remove NetworkCapabilities#combine*" am: 5469fa6e59
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1919248
Change-Id: I4b385d93b24ea85240dde589b2357543fb80c122
2021-12-14 11:14:57 +00:00
Jean Chalard
5469fa6e59
Merge "Remove NetworkCapabilities#combine*"
2021-12-14 10:47:31 +00:00
Aswin Sankar
ce0fdcb616
DnsException: run only on T+ versions am: 5d16f41639 am: cef564eb4f am: 1b29dd3d2b
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1921304
Change-Id: Ib1efecd41c6fa5fea46b1c443027f09bcd8353a8
2021-12-14 05:00:54 +00:00
Aswin Sankar
cef564eb4f
DnsException: run only on T+ versions am: 5d16f41639
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1921304
Change-Id: I81b7420a00fd8a0cce81db0e07dd76e0a9d6313c
2021-12-14 04:29:38 +00:00
Aswin Sankar
5d16f41639
DnsException: run only on T+ versions
...
- Test was failing on S mainline builds. Fixing forward.
Bug: 210540375
Test: CtsDnsResolverTests.
Change-Id: Ia980965c8ee1b9ddae99f593628f8b7ecfeca394
2021-12-14 02:44:54 +00:00
Taras Antoshchuk
673eb6ecd2
Add CTS tests for exclude VPN routes APIs
...
Add HostsideVpnTests test cases for different combinations of
included/excluded routes in VPN configuration.
Bug: 186082280
Test: atest HostsideVpnTests
Change-Id: I993a32d4066a851eb0c455aff2f599569e958ba7
2021-12-13 18:47:58 +01:00
Chalard Jean
bdf4f2987d
Remove NetworkCapabilities#combine*
...
This is no longer used outside of tests, and can be safely
removed.
Also this family of methods is fairly confusing, as while
it's well defined for some members, many later additions
had to be written so as to dissallow some combinations when
the workings of this family of methods didn't match the
semantics of some members, making them possibly dangerous
to use and at least exhibit difficult to understand semantics.
Test: FrameworksNetTests
m
Change-Id: Ia69c20afa16c2153839891f6e33331caa9da33ff
2021-12-13 21:15:34 +09:00
Taras Antoshchuk
a5a1b80222
Unhide IpPrefix(InetAddress, int)
...
Unhide IpPrefix constructor to allow its usage with the new
VpnService.Builder#excludeRoute(IpPrefix) method.
Bug: 186082280
Test: atest IpPrefixTest
Change-Id: Ie5b62b2b206def1be53a41219681b4a8bc06c1d2
2021-12-13 11:11:00 +01:00
Taras Antoshchuk
62065db8d1
Unhide RouteInfo#getType and related fields
...
Bug: 186082280
Test: atest RouteInfoTest
Change-Id: I59b9185cf4f8f2afd691b49cf6b4659fe36e6bf8
2021-12-13 11:11:00 +01:00
Treehugger Robot
1ac62ba743
Merge changes from topic "DnsException" am: 0db3016398 am: d109712194 am: de3683b97c
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1908042
Change-Id: I432576048f5c094c43dc64d26060d83f876adad8
2021-12-13 08:41:39 +00:00
Treehugger Robot
d109712194
Merge changes from topic "DnsException" am: 0db3016398
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1908042
Change-Id: I4bfb3fc34f10d0c84dafc949f4e7f604d98244e1
2021-12-13 08:04:17 +00:00
Treehugger Robot
0db3016398
Merge changes from topic "DnsException"
...
* changes:
CTS DnsResolverTest for DnsException ctor
DnsResolver: Make DnsException ctor public
2021-12-13 07:48:28 +00:00
Aswin Sankar
7dca331853
Merge "DnsResolverTest: Use AndroidJUnit4.class" am: 85509fb3e4 am: 7e184fc11e am: 99292155a2
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1918397
Change-Id: Ic3f0edee27e579759dfa09c50c9096fc129485d5
2021-12-13 07:29:04 +00:00
Aswin Sankar
7e184fc11e
Merge "DnsResolverTest: Use AndroidJUnit4.class" am: 85509fb3e4
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1918397
Change-Id: Ifd5f103d5bfa2ea2d0817efff65aaa1a4c60b8a9
2021-12-13 06:49:19 +00:00
Aswin Sankar
85509fb3e4
Merge "DnsResolverTest: Use AndroidJUnit4.class"
2021-12-13 06:28:08 +00:00
Jean Chalard
2658430120
Merge "Fix an issue where OEM pref tests don't clean up correctly" am: bbb7ae75d1 am: d2afada37a am: ed9604bacd
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1906316
Change-Id: I6becbf85bff36054086d9dccc5a26bd6720766fa
2021-12-13 02:50:39 +00:00
Jean Chalard
d2afada37a
Merge "Fix an issue where OEM pref tests don't clean up correctly" am: bbb7ae75d1
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1906316
Change-Id: Ifed130bc06f0d79f1039f31574b9d2a857564c8e
2021-12-13 02:20:29 +00:00
Jean Chalard
bbb7ae75d1
Merge "Fix an issue where OEM pref tests don't clean up correctly"
2021-12-13 02:06:38 +00:00
Mingguang Xu
c3b974041b
Add CTS for DhcpOption am: 4df5d1fdd2 am: 9e4d6d2dc6 am: 1a43b8b120
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1917689
Change-Id: I6eb9efccc18bed3a9fe81ad6d34e293f0e147ff6
2021-12-11 02:29:22 +00:00
Mingguang Xu
9e4d6d2dc6
Add CTS for DhcpOption am: 4df5d1fdd2
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1917689
Change-Id: Ic4a33e417830ff534da1e56895159935b2a85ae9
2021-12-11 01:51:37 +00:00
Mingguang Xu
4df5d1fdd2
Add CTS for DhcpOption
...
Bug: 177278970
Test: this
Change-Id: Ia9a9384cb39c049253ead8f7eb594505ccf08333
2021-12-10 23:26:36 +00:00
Treehugger Robot
23ec69be0f
Merge "[MS07.2] Move NetworkStatsCollection/IdentitySet into frameworks" am: 7577131341 am: a9656625d2 am: bb49fe4bef
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1895330
Change-Id: Id03f0efb4d052fd2da6bfd3d50bbb9a94cd299da
2021-12-10 19:35:17 +00:00
Benedict Wong
8e6b02445e
Merge "Add additional IPsec owners" am: b1c6bf8ece am: 81288cfce7 am: 9906f6e12e
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1910250
Change-Id: Ia424c7a5ee3dce24ad5cdbc34df31e3b51848d9c
2021-12-10 19:34:42 +00:00
Aswin Sankar
ca942be00d
CTS DnsResolverTest for DnsException ctor
...
- Adds a CTS test to verify that DnsException
can be subclassed and its constructor re-used.
Test: Adds testDnsExceptionConstructor() CTS test.
Bug: 208479811
Change-Id: Ia1dffe8ad5252b61af5a6ef0f6630f075081a6d1
2021-12-10 19:30:20 +00:00
Aswin Sankar
6ed0167930
DnsResolverTest: Use AndroidJUnit4.class
...
These CTS tests previously extended AndroidTestCase, which made useful
annotations like 'DevSdkIgnoreRule' not take effect.
Test: CtsNetTestCasesLatestSdk
Bug: 208479811
Change-Id: I79f7e48167bb3bfbd4f6cde33d7e3907c2af6f74
2021-12-10 19:30:15 +00:00
Treehugger Robot
a9656625d2
Merge "[MS07.2] Move NetworkStatsCollection/IdentitySet into frameworks" am: 7577131341
...
Original change: https://android-review.googlesource.com/c/platform/packages/modules/Connectivity/+/1895330
Change-Id: I3d84b1a82e07a9b4a56ddc88f3f81d875870517c
2021-12-10 18:57:07 +00:00
Treehugger Robot
7577131341
Merge "[MS07.2] Move NetworkStatsCollection/IdentitySet into frameworks"
2021-12-10 18:48:52 +00:00
Aaron Huang
9792b5b5e6
Add makeDependencies method in IpSecService related tests
...
Bug: 204153604
Test: FrameworksNetTest
Change-Id: Iea5731273e4772966466088f11a4c6334fa19f5d
2021-12-10 12:11:20 +00:00